In view of Jens Pedersen, Senior Analyst at Danske Bank, the outlook on the Swedish currency seems positive in the near term horizon.
Key Quotes
“In Scandies, risk aversion took a firm grip on EUR/SEK yesterday as the Italian crisis escalated, and price action suggests Sweden’s AAA status is not yet a strong attraction”.
“While the Riksbank expects a stronger SEK, a euro crisis would see SEK appreciation for the wrong reasons. Our short-term models have fair value in the 9.20-30 region for what it’s worth (which is perhaps not so much right now)”.
